The Native American $1 Coin Program is one of the most historically significant modern coin series produced by the United States Mint. Authorized by the Native American $1 Coin Act of 2007, the program began in 2009 and honors the important contributions of Native American tribes and individuals to the development of the United States. Unlike most circulating coin series, the reverse design changes every year, allowing the Mint to tell a new story with each issue.
